The Director of Community Engagement & Marketing is responsible for leading the Boys & Girls Club of Greater Salem’s marketing, communications, public relations, community outreach, and event execution efforts. This individual plays a key role in promoting the Club’s mission, programs, events, and impact throughout the community.

Working closely with the Director of Resource Development, this role develops and implements marketing strategies that increase community awareness, donor engagement, event participation, and organizational visibility. This position also supports the planning and execution of fundraising and community events while helping strengthen relationships with families, sponsors, volunteers, media outlets, and community partners.

The Director of Community Engagement & Marketing serves as the primary lead for marketing execution, communications, and event coordination while supporting the broader development goals of the organization.

Essential Responsibilities

Marketing & Communications

  • Develop and implement marketing and communication strategies that promote the Club’s mission, programs, events, campaigns, and impact
  • Create and manage content for social media, email marketing, website updates, newsletters, press releases, annual reports, and printed materials
  • Maintain brand consistency across all organizational communications and promotional materials
  • Coordinate media outreach and public relations opportunities
  • Capture and share stories, photos, and impact messaging that highlight Club youth, programs, donors, sponsors, and community partnerships
  • Support donor communications, sponsorship recognition, and fundraising campaign visibility efforts

Community Engagement & Partnerships

  • Build and maintain positive relationships with community organizations, businesses, schools, volunteers, media partners, and local stakeholders
  • Represent the Club at community events, networking opportunities, and outreach initiatives
  • Support volunteer engagement and community awareness efforts
  • Assist with sponsor engagement, recognition activities, and stewardship support

Event Planning & Execution

  • Coordinate logistics and execution for fundraising events, community events, campaigns, and organizational initiatives
  • Work collaboratively with the Director of Resource Development to support sponsorship fulfillment, event marketing, timelines, budgets, vendor coordination, and event execution
  • Develop event promotional materials, signage, programs, scripts, and communication plans
  • Assist with event setup, coordination, registration, and on-site management
  • Support event committees and community engagement efforts tied to fundraising initiatives
  • Assist with post-event communications, sponsor acknowledgements, and reporting

Digital & Public Presence

  • Manage and update website content and online event/fundraising platforms
  • Oversee social media scheduling, engagement, and digital campaign performance
  • Support CRM and donor database communications through coordinated marketing and engagement efforts
  • Monitor marketing analytics and provide recommendations for increased engagement and visibility

Organizational Support

  • Support Club programs and organizational initiatives through marketing and community outreach efforts
  • Collaborate with staff across departments to promote Club activities and successes
  • Assist with additional projects and duties as assigned

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ree preferred in marketing, communications, public relations, nonprofit management, or related field or equivalent experience
  • Minimum 2 years of experience (4 preferred) in marketing, communications, event planning, donor engagement, or community outreach
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Experience with social media management, email marketing, content creation, and CRM systems
  • Strong organizational and project management abilities
  • Ability to work collaboratively and manage multiple projects simultaneously
  • Experience with Canva, Constant Contact, donor management systems, social media platforms, website management, and event software preferred
